The CEO of Volvo Cars, Håkan Samuelsson, has stated that a price war on cars could spread to Europe. He noted that competition is intensifying on the European car market, and there is a larger supply than demand. Samuelsson said that companies may need to lower prices in Europe, but this could be combined with reducing costs.

He also mentioned that there is a significant opportunity to see many new Chinese cars in Europe, as price pressure has already been strong in China and could now spread.
